Warning Signs You Need Insulation Water Damage Restoration

Catching insulation water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ent health risks associated with mold and mildew.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show hidden moisture in your insulation which can lead to mold and mildew grow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s time to call our team.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Visible water stains can be a sign of a more serious issue don’t ignore them!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

High Energy Bills

Increased energy bills can be a sign of insulation damage it’s not just a coincidence! Our team can help you identify the issue and provide a solution to get your energy bills back under control.

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ost in Cottonwood Heights, UT

The cost of Insulation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cottonwood Heights, UT.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, size of affected area
Insulation Repair and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of damage, type of insulation
Final Inspection and Clean-up $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
